    27-680 ENG02 – User's SW-Manual for the HMTL5 panels PCD7.D5xx Configuration of the web client 1.2.3 Configure the Network interface By default, all network interfaces a configured for DHCP. The ETH0 (For PCD7.D5xxCF beside the power connector) is configured as WAN port. If you connect the panel to the network using ETH0 and a DHCP server is running the Ip-Address is automatically re- quested from the DHCP server.

    27-680 ENG02 – User's SW-Manual for the HMTL5 panels PCD7.D5xx Touch screen calibration Touch screen calibration System Setting Calibration allows to calibrate Touchscreen device and can be accessed by the tap-tap procedure. Tap-tap consists in a sequence of several touch activations by simple means of the finger tapping the touch screen performed during the power-up phase and started immediately after the HMI is powered on.
